Ich greife das noch einmal auf. Habe jetzt folgenden HTML-Quellcode:
[..]
<body>
<div class="main">
<div class="logo_top" align="center"><img src="logo_top.jpg" alt="" style="border:medium solid #EEEEEE;"></div>
<!-- Navigation -->
<div class="navi_left">
<div class="suppnt">Ueberpunkt</div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="suppnt">Ueberpunkt</div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="suppnt">Ueberpunkt</div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
<div class="navipoint"><a href="index.php">Unterpunkt</a></div>
</div>
<!-- Navigation Ende -->
<div class="inhalt">
~~~~~~php
<?php echo ".inhalt\n"; ?>
~~~~~~html
</div>
<span class="footer">© 2005 - Street-Tigers Nebringen</span>
</div>
</body>
[..]
der mit folgendem CSS formatiert ist:
a{
color:#000000;
text-decoration:none;
}
/* --------------------------- */
/* Navigation */
.navi_left{
background-color:#FFFFFF;
border:thin solid #000000;
width:22%;
margin:3% 0 0 3%;
float:left;
}
.suppnt{
margin-left:5%;
font-weight:bold;
border-top:thin dashed #CCCCCC;
border-bottom:thin dashed #CCCCCC;
}
.navipoint{
width:100%;
border-top:thin dashed #CCCCCC;
border-bottom:thin dashed #CCCCCC;
}
.navipoint a{
margin-left:10%;
}
.navipoint:hover{
background-color:#DDDDDD;
background-image:url(005.gif);
background-position:right;
background-repeat:no-repeat;
}
.navipoint:hover a{
color:#003366;
font-weight:bold;
}
/* Erscheinungsbild */
body{
font-family:Arial, Helvetica, sans-serif;
font-size:13.4px;
background-color:#E6E6E6;
}
.main{
border:thin solid #000000;
width:75%;
background-color:#D1E4E2;
position:relative;
}
.logo_top{
margin-top:3%;
}
/* Content-div */
.inhalt{
border:thin solid #000000;
float:right;
margin-right:2%;
}
/* Footer */
span.footer{
background-color:#FF9900;
margin-bottom:3%;
margin-top:3%;
text-align:center;
display:block;
border-top:thin solid #000000;
border-bottom:thin solid #000000;
clear:both;
}
Also das mit clear klappt nicht. Und floaten möchte ich das div.main nicht, weil das eigentlich in die Mitte soll.
Kann mir jemand sagen, wie ich das anstellen muss, damit das div.inhalt neben das div.navi_left kommt?